Output c6513dca6afedf14fa2e369fff8903a6136efd821241307e61d7cf6ae1765927:0

value
80578116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8738efccd99be9d7e01c7c906a3e56bf19eb7cf OP_EQUAL
address
3KxuW4LPCpWnwdmuJKnFAtmFGv59D8Ctty
transaction
c6513dca6afedf14fa2e369fff8903a6136efd821241307e61d7cf6ae1765927
spent
true